1. Common symptoms of sinusitis

The main symptoms of sinusitis include:
| Symptoms | Description |
|---|---|
| nasal congestion | Unilateral or bilateral nasal obstruction |
| runny nose | Yellow or green purulent nasal discharge |
| headache | Swelling and pain in forehead or face |
| loss of sense of smell | Decreased odor discrimination ability |
2. Drug treatment options for sinusitis
According to recent medical expert recommendations and clinical guidelines, drug treatments for sinusitis mainly include the following categories:
| drug type | Representative medicine | function | Usage and dosage |
|---|---|---|---|
| antibiotics | amoxicillin, clavulanic acid | Kill bacteria | Follow doctor's advice, usually 7-10 days |
| Nasal hormones | budesonide nasal spray | Reduce inflammation | 1-2 times a day |
| Decongestant | pseudoephedrine | Relieve nasal congestion | Short term use 3-5 days |
| mucolytic agent | acetylcysteine | dilute secretions | 2-3 times a day |

4. Medication precautions
1.Antibiotic use principles: Must be used under the guidance of a doctor to avoid abuse leading to drug resistance.
2.Safety of nasal steroids: Topical use of hormones has low systemic absorption, but long-term use requires monitoring.
3.Decongestant Limitations: Use continuously for no more than 7 days to prevent rebound nasal congestion.
4.Medication for special populations: Pregnant women and children should pay special attention to drug selection.

6. When Do You Need Medical Treatment?
You should seek medical treatment promptly when the following situations occur:
1. Symptoms persist for more than 10 days without improvement
2. High fever (body temperature exceeds 38.5℃)
3. Vision changes or eye swelling
4. Severe headache or neck stiffness
Treatment of sinusitis requires choosing the right medication based on the severity and cause of the condition. It is recommended that patients use medications rationally under the guidance of a doctor and never use antibiotics or decongestants on their own for long periods of time. With regular treatment and proper care, most people with sinusitis can achieve good results.
